Myomo, Inc., a portable medical robotics company, designs, develops and produces myoelectric braces for people with neuromuscular disorders in the United States. The company is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.

Novartis AG researches, develops, manufactures and markets medical devices worldwide. The company is headquartered in Basel, Switzerland.
